Transaction 253c3cf70936b47874c862db2cc82458feabba08313432e159ed963768b32f20
1 Input
2 Outputs
- 253c3cf70936b47874c862db2cc82458feabba08313432e159ed963768b32f20:0
- 253c3cf70936b47874c862db2cc82458feabba08313432e159ed963768b32f20:1
value 284895
address 3MV2Wmz2KNfrVeJgxMNbwL9B4JZc38oQRQ
value 383016
address 158usT8JFQroUH2woGzrwae6hXvKNaBBQj